How much do robotic process automation remote j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 21, 2026, the average yearly pay for robotic process automation remote in Dallas, TX is $106,756.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$83,600.00 and $129,100.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Robotic Process Automation Remote vs RPA Developer?

AspectRobotic Process Automation RemoteRPA Developer
CredentialsTypically requires RPA certifications and basic programming knowledgeRequires RPA certifications, programming skills, and software development experience
Work EnvironmentRemote, often part of a larger automation teamRemote or on-site, focused on developing and implementing automation solutions
Industry UsageUsed across various industries for process automationPrimarily in IT, finance, and healthcare sectors for automation development

Robotic Process Automation Remote roles often involve overseeing automation projects remotely, while RPA Developers focus on designing and coding automation solutions. Both roles require similar certifications but differ in technical depth and responsibilities.

Prismfly is looking for a driven Automation Specialist who can design, implement, and manage a fully automated sales engine. The ideal candidate will be committed to optimizing lead generation and scaling our business development efforts through automation tools and strategies.

RESPONSIBILITIES:


  • Develop, implement, and optimize end-to-end automation work flows for lead generation, outreach, follow-ups, and sales tracking.
  • Identify and integrate CRM and sales automation tools to enhance efficiency
  • Automate email campaigns, proposal generation, and reporting for the business development team.
  • Build systems to automatically identify, qualify, and prioritize leads using AI-driven tools and platforms.
  • Implement data scraping, enrichment, and segmentation strategies to target ideal customer profiles.
  • Create and maintain automated processes for updating and cleansing lead database.
  • Work closely with the Business Development team to understand their needs and tailor automation solutions accordingly.
  • Stay updated on the latest trends in automation, business development, and sales enablement technologies.


IDEAL CANDIDATE WILL HAVE:

  • Availability to work full time (9AM-5PM CT)
  • Must be an expert in Google Sheets, Zapier and ChatGPT
  • Experienced in using the following tools: browse.ai, Clay.io, Pipedrive, Airtable, Make.com. HubSpot CRM, and Apollo.io.
  • Ability to work and communicate with different teams to create and develop solutions
  • Experienced in working with ecommerce agencies
